Understanding Safety Signs and Their Importance
The Definition and Purpose of Safety Signs
Safety signs are visual indicators that alert individuals to potential hazards, required protective measures, or emergency procedures in a given area. Whether in manufacturing plants, hospitals, construction sites, or office environments, these signs serve to:
-
Prevent accidents by warning of dangers.
-
Guide behavior by indicating required or prohibited actions.
-
Promote awareness of surroundings and potential hazards.
Legal Requirements and Compliance Standards
Compliance with organizations like OSHA (Occupational Safety and Health Administration) and ANSI (American National Standards Institute) mandates the use of specific types of safety signs. OSHA, for example, requires employers to use color-coded signs with recognizable symbols and legible fonts to communicate risks effectively.
According to OSHA, failure to comply with proper signage regulations can result in fines and increased injury risks.
Types of Safety Signs and Their Specific Roles
1. Warning Signs
Indicate a potential hazard that may lead to serious injury. Examples include signs for high voltage, slippery floors, or toxic chemicals.
2. Mandatory Signs
These signs instruct personnel to perform a specific action, such as wearing protective equipment (e.g., "Wear Safety Glasses").
3. Prohibition Signs
Communicate actions that are not allowed in a specific area, like "No Smoking" or "Do Not Enter."
4. Emergency Information Signs
Provide direction to emergency exits, first-aid kits, or eyewash stations, ensuring timely response during critical situations.
5. Fire Safety Signs
Highlight the location of fire extinguishers, hoses, and alarm stations, which is essential in fire-prone environments.
How Safety Signs Prevent Workplace Injuries
Enhancing Situational Awareness
Clear, strategically placed signs alert employees to immediate hazards, helping them make informed decisions. For instance, a sign warning about wet floors can prevent slips and falls, which are a leading cause of workplace injuries according to the National Safety Council.
Promoting Consistent Safety Behavior
When employees regularly encounter mandatory or warning signs, it reinforces safe working habits. Over time, this normalization can significantly reduce unsafe practices.
Facilitating Quick Emergency Responses
In emergencies, signs that point to exits or first-aid stations are vital. They minimize confusion and guide quick, life-saving actions.
Reducing Language Barriers
Well-designed safety signs often use pictograms and color codes, making them universally understandable regardless of language proficiency.
Best Practices for Implementing Safety Signs
Conduct a Workplace Risk Assessment
Identify all areas where hazards exist and assess which type of safety sign is most appropriate.
Follow ANSI/OSHA Standards
Ensure your signs conform to ANSI Z535 and OSHA 1910.145 standards for consistency, visibility, and readability.
Use Durable and Legible Materials
Safety signs should be made from materials that withstand environmental conditions—whether indoors or outdoors—without fading or damage.
Place Signs Strategically
Install signs at eye level, in well-lit areas, and close to the hazard for maximum effectiveness.
Provide Regular Training
Educate employees about the meaning and importance of different types of signs through onboarding and periodic refresher courses.
Maintain and Update Signage
Conduct regular inspections to ensure that all signs are visible, intact, and up to date with current standards and workplace conditions.

Challenges and Considerations
Sign Overload
Too many signs in one area can overwhelm workers and reduce overall effectiveness. Use hierarchy and prioritization to avoid visual clutter.
Wear and Tear
In industrial settings, signs can get dirty or damaged quickly. Establish a maintenance plan to ensure long-term functionality.
Customization Needs
Standard signs may not always fit unique workplace hazards. Invest in custom signage when necessary to address specific safety concerns.
